Arista Records, Home to Old Dominion and Brooks & Dunn, Closes

Arista Records, an imprint of Sony Music Nashville, has closed its doors. The label, home to Old Dominion, Brooks & Dunn, Ryan Hurd, Seaforth, Morgan Wade, Adam Doleac and Megan Moroney, is no longer in operation.
